Creamy Polenta with Wild Mushroom Ragout and Truffle Butter from the Ceratal® Evo Pan
Creamy polenta with aromatic wild mushroom ragout and delicate truffle butter – a hearty dish with intense mushroom and truffle flavors.

Ingredients
| FOR THE POLENTA: | |
| 200 g | Polenta (corn semolina) |
| 800 ml | vegetable stock (or water) |
| 50 g | Parmesan, grated |
| 50 g | butter |
| salt | |
| pepper | |
| FOR THE WILD MUSHROOM RAGOUT: | |
| 400 g | wild mushrooms (e.g. porcini, chanterelles, button mushrooms) |
| 2 tbsp | olive oil |
| 1 | onion, finely chopped |
| 2 | garlic cloves, finely chopped |
| 100 ml | white wine (optional) |
| 100 ml | vegetable stock |
| 1 tsp | thyme, fresh and chopped |
| 1 tsp | rosemary, fresh and chopped |
| salt | |
| pepper | |
| 1 tbsp | parsley, fresh and chopped |
| FOR THE TRUFFLE BUTTER: | |
| 100 g | butter, at room temperature |
| 1-2 tsp | truffle oil or fresh truffle |
| salt | |
| pepper |
Instructions
Step 1 of 9:
Bring the vegetable broth to a boil in a pot.
Step 2 of 9:
Add the polenta slowly, stirring constantly. Reduce the heat and simmer for about 15-20 minutes, stirring, until the polenta is thick and creamy.
Step 3 of 9:
Stir the butter and grated Parmesan into the polenta. Season with salt and pepper.
Step 4 of 9:
Clean the wild mushrooms for the ragout and chop them roughly.
Step 5 of 9:
Heat the olive oil in a pan. Sauté the onion and garlic in it until translucent.
Step 6 of 9:
Add the prepared mushrooms and sauté over medium heat until soft.
Step 7 of 9:
Optionally add the white wine and let it reduce briefly. Then add the vegetable stock and fresh herbs. Season with salt and pepper and let simmer for another 5 minutes.
Step 8 of 9:
Mix the room-temperature butter thoroughly in a bowl with the truffle oil or the chopped fresh truffle, salt, and pepper.
Step 9 of 9:
Add a spoonful of truffle butter to the wild mushroom ragout so it melts slightly. Sprinkle with fresh parsley. Spread the ragout generously over the polenta or serve separately.
